The bond angle of SF2 is around 98º. The lewis structure of SF2 has 4 bonding electrons and 16 nonbonding electrons. The hybridization for SF2 is Sp 3. SF2 is polar because of its bent geometrical shape and large electronegativity difference between sulfur and a fluorine atom.

What is polar and non-polar? Polar. "In chemistry, polarity is a separation of electric charge leading to a molecule or its chemical groups having an electric dipole or multipole moment. Polar molecules must contain polar bonds due to a difference in electronegativity between the bonded atoms.difference of 0.4 to 1.7 (on the Pauling scale) is considered polar covalent. Polar molecules have a non-zero net dipole moment. Both CO 2 and H 2O have two polar bonds. However the dipoles in the linear CO 2 molecule cancel each other out, meaning that the CO 2 molecule is non-polar. Polar molecules must contain polar bonds due to a difference in electronegativity between the bonded atoms.Mar 12, 2023 · Sulfite (SO 32-) is a polar molecular ion. It consists of polar bonds, including one S=O and two S-O bonds, due to an electronegativity difference of 0.86 units between the bonded S-atom (E.N = 2.58) and O-atom (E.N = 3.44). The central S-atom contains one lone pair of electrons, due to which the sulfite (SO 32-) ion has an asymmetrical ...

Its trigonal planar form, sulfur trioxide (SO3) is a nonpolar molecule., However, despite the presence of polar bonds, SiF4 is a nonpolar molecule. This is because the molecule has a symmetric tetrahedral molecular geometry. The four fluorine atoms are arranged around the central silicon atom in a tetrahedral shape, with the bond angles between them being approximately 109.5 degrees., Is CO32- polar or nonpolar?I think it is nonpolar, but I want to make sure because I have a take home quiz.
